2. Flexibility
The best vacuum cleaners are able to perform a variety of chores in your home, from quick dusting to deep cleaning carpets. They're typically lightweight and easy to move around, and should also offer a range of attachments that will meet your requirements.
Consider a vacuum designed to handle hair from pets if you have pets. They typically have a dedicated power brush that sucks pet hair from the main floorhead and directs it to the dust cup so that it doesn't block or get caught in the brush roll.
Many of our top-rated vacuums also have smart features that integrate with your home's systems or adjust to different flooring types and levels of dirt. This is particularly crucial for people suffering from allergies, since these features stop dust particles from circulating back in the air.
Vacuums can be expensive, but they go for sale during major events like Black Friday and Amazon Prime Day. There are also deals during the spring season, when retailers announce sales to coincide with the annual spring cleaning of customers.
The lifespan of a vacuum may vary according to the model and how you make use of it. The majority of our top-rated vacuums last for an average of eight years. If you want yours to outlast the competition, choose one with an extended guarantee.

For example our top choice in this category, the Shark Stratos cordless vacuum, was a breeze to maneuver and used the lowest amount of battery power during our testing. It also has automatic adjusting suction as well as an elegant LCD display that has an indicator for the battery and the ability to switch between Eco, Auto and boost modes.
The Stratos also took in ground coffee, kibble and flour effortlessly in our tests, and it did a great job at removing carpets with low pile by removing the sand and rice in only a few passes. It also has a soft front-facing brushroll that can capture small particles and stop pet hair from spitting back out, and a stiff rear brushroll that sinks into carpeting.
The budget-friendly Kenmore Elite sucks up wet spills and messes that can be found on hard floors thanks to the power of its dual brushroll design, but it's still light enough to move up and down stairs as well as across the home without breaking sweat. It's easier to care for than many other upright models, too, with an easily removable HEPA filter and a disposable dust bag that can be replaced when full.
4. Versatility
The Levoit is a versatile model that can handle the majority of cleaning tasks. It may not have all the features found in more expensive models, but its primary features make it a good choice for everyday use. It has an 8-foot hose which can reach over floors and a large dust cup that's easy to empty.
Its brush roll is designed to capture and suck up hair without wrapping the bristles around it, making it a great option for households with hairy animals or even people who shed many tears. The results of tests conducted on it also demonstrated that it can take on all kinds of debris including carpets with low pile and hard floors; it even managed to remove sand, rice, and Cheerios from carpeting.
The Miele Flex Vac is a versatile cordless vacuum that has a powerful motor. It was particularly effective in cleaning pet hair, and also took larger particles such as cereal, though it was unable to tackle more caked-on debris, such as car dirt. It also has a wide selection of attachments, including an electric power nozzle that can make short work of dirt and pet hair on upholstery.

6. Ease of Cleaning
The best vacuums make cleaning up messes easy. The Levoit LVAC-200 is a light compact vacuum cleaner that's powerful. In our tests, it took in everything from kibble and ground coffee to dog hair. The dual brushrolls snatch pet hair and other large particles without spitting them out or wrapping them around the cleaner head. This prevents blocking. The motorized tool is able to remove embedded pet hair even from areas that are difficult to reach.
Another highlight is the Shark Stratos Cordless, which easily handled pet hair and other large debris in our standard tests. The main floorhead is equipped with a soft brushroll to capture fine dust and debris. The second floorhead that has bristles that are rigid, can reach deeper into carpeting to tackle larger dirt. The dust cup is large and easy to empty.
If your home is carpeted heavily, think about an upright or full-size vacuum with beater bars for more thorough cleaning sessions. Select a vacuum cleaner that is wet dry that can handle both floors and messes caused by food or water. Examples include the Miele Cat & Dog, or the Henry Hoover. These machines can handle an array of household debris, from tiny pieces of food to huge messes, and might have more advanced features than handhelds on this list.
